Vice presidential candidate Tim Kaine ended a whirlwind day of campaigning by playing harmonica alongside rock singer Jon Bon Jovi in Florida.
The Democrat jammed to Bon Jovi’s classic 1986 tune, You Give Love a Bad Name, at the State Theatre in St Petersburg.
Bon Jovi played a few songs, including Living on a Prayer, and Kaine came on stage and spoke before the final tune.
The rocker said he has been a long-time supporter of Hillary Clinton.

“These are trying times. Anyone who tells you this election is over, it’s not,” Bon Jovi said, urging people to get out to vote if they had not already.
Bon Jovi joked that he would start a band called TK and the Faithful.
